Does anyone else not feel pregnant? Granted, I'm only 4w5d, but I have no symptoms at all. And emotionally, I feel like I won't let myself believe it. I even tested again this morning because I convinced myself that the test I took last week must have been a false positive.

Not feeling like I'm pregnant is actually helping me to not worry so much. But at the same time, I'm concerned that if this little bean actually sticks, that I won't be able to bond and really enjoy my pregnancy.

Does anyone else feel this way? If you did in the beginning, did you find you were eventually able to bond and connect with your baby while you were pregnant? When did it start to feel real?
 
i've not felt pregnant the whole way so far :) not a symptom or anything...
 
I didnt feel bad until about 6 weeks and started to feel better in week 15. I still don't have much of a bump, but I am feeling baby albeit with no set pattern, so sometimes its real, sometimes not. I think that things will be different in a few weeks but sometimes I do forget im pregnant !!!
 
I am over 12 weeks now. At your stage i did not feel pregnant either. But when i hit 5 and half weeks i got bad morning sickness (which i still have now) extreame tiredness and dizziness. I do feel pregnant now and hoping that all the symptoms will start to ease up soon. It is quite normal for many women who are going to get these symptoms to get them a bit later (5 - 6 weeks) so enjoy the time you feel normal!
